VEHICLE MINING SYSTEM (VMS) FAQ
What is Vehicle Mining System (VMS) and how does it work?
The Vehicle Mining System (VMS) integrates cryptocurrency mining with electric vehicles. It leverages the power from a vehicle's operating alternator to resolve the significant electrical and energy challenges faced by traditional mining. Essentially, VMS enables users to mine cryptocurrency while driving their car, with future plans to allow payments using the coins mined directly from moving vehicles.
What problem does VMS aim to solve?
VMS aims to tackle the substantial energy consumption and heat generation problems inherent in traditional cryptocurrency mining. By integrating with electric vehicles and utilizing their power generation, VMS offers a more sustainable, efficient, and environmentally friendly approach to crypto mining.
What are the use cases for VMS tokens?
VMS tokens have several key use cases. Primarily, they are earned through vehicle-based mining and can be traded on virtual asset exchanges. Future utility will include integration with electric vehicle charging systems and serving as a payment method across various platforms. Additionally, users can participate in financial management activities like staking with VMS tokens.
How can users earn VMS tokens?
Users can primarily earn VMS tokens by equipping their vehicles with the VMS system, allowing them to mine VMS coins directly through onboard mining computers while driving. Beyond active mining, the project also outlines opportunities for users to earn VMS through passive income methods such as staking or lending their tokens.
